How do I hide inactive customers in Balance Detail Report?

I'm using QB to keep track of rental property and the residents' accounts. After a tenant moves out, the customer becomes "inactive" but there is no way to filter "active only" customers in the Balance Detail Report. I only have 6 customers but like 20 other old customers showing in my Balance Detail Report... which makes it very difficult to find my active tenants.

How do I hide inactive customers in Balance Detail Report?

"Some tenants on list have been gone for more than 2 years and have 0 balance, still on list."

Then you have Open balances and open payments never applied against each other.

An Open Balance report or AR reports should not show anyone, if their balance is 0. If you see the name, then the math is 0, but the cross-posting transactions are not applied to each other.

If you run a Balance Detail, that is the review of the customer's entire activity, so the point of this report is to see if they are at 0 or not.

How do I hide inactive customers in Balance Detail Report?

Hi @ChrisF_060,

 

Allow me to join this conversation and provide some insights about this query.

 

As what @lyndaartesani stated above, as long as a customer had transactions on the date range you selected, even if they're inactive or have a zero balance, they will appear on that report.
 

Although we don't have an option to exclude inactive customers or those with zero balances in the report, you can manually select the customer you want to see on the report by using Filters.

 

Let me show you how:

  1. Go to the Reports tab.
  2. Choose Customers & Receivables.
  3. Select Customer Balance Detail.
  4. Tap the Customize Report tab.
  5. Go to the Filters tab.
  6. From the Filters box, select Name.
  7. From the Name drop-down, click Multiple names.
  8. Mark the customers with pending balances.
  9. Click OK twice.
  10. Update the report Dates.

Good morning, @goldcoastwebdesign

 

Thanks for following the thread. 

 

The purpose of setting customers to inactive is when you no longer need to have the customer on your list. The option to make the customer inactive is a way of removing them. QuickBooks won't allow you to delete the customer if you have any transaction history with them for accounting purposes. Such as invoices, payments, or receipts.
